Characterizing AFCL Serverless Scientific Workflows in Federated FaaS

被引:3
|
作者
Hautz, Mika [1 ]
Ristov, Sashko [1 ]
Felderer, Michael [2 ]
机构
[1] Univ Innsbruck, Comp Sci Dept, Innsbruck, Tyrol, Austria
[2] German Aerosp Ctr DLR, Inst Software Technol, Cologne, Germany
关键词
Function-as-a-Service; federation; serverless; scientific workflows;
D O I
10.1145/3631295.3631397
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
This paper introduces several, publicly available, serverless scientific workflows Montage, BWA, and Monte Carlo developed at a high level of abstraction using the Abstract Function Choreography Language (AFCL). Any individual function can run across federated FaaS comprising cloud regions of AWS and GCP. We present the support for composition with AFCL and execution with the xAFCL serverless workflow management system. For each AFCL workflow, we present implementation details, networking, and complexity. The evaluation of the presented serverless workflows shows that workflow functions download ephemeral data and run computation faster on AWS than on GCP. However, functions on GCP upload faster on the collocated storage.
引用
收藏
页码:24 / 29
页数:6
相关论文
共 50 条
  • [41] PrivFlow: Secure and Privacy Preserving Serverless Workflows on Cloud
    Garg, Surabhi
    Thakur, Meena Singh Dilip
    Rajan, M. A.
    Maddali, Lakshmi Padmaja
    Ramachandran, Vigneswaran
    2023 IEEE/ACM 23RD INTERNATIONAL SYMPOSIUM ON CLUSTER, CLOUD AND INTERNET COMPUTING, CCGRID, 2023, : 447 - 458
  • [42] High Performance Serverless Architecture for Deep Learning Workflows
    Chahal, Dheeraj
    Ramesh, Manju
    Ojha, Ravi
    Singhal, Rekha
    21ST IEEE/ACM INTERNATIONAL SYMPOSIUM ON CLUSTER, CLOUD AND INTERNET COMPUTING (CCGRID 2021), 2021, : 790 - 796
  • [43] VALVE: Securing Function Workflows on Serverless Computing Platforms
    Datta, Pubali
    Kumar, Prabuddha
    Morris, Tristan
    Grace, Michael
    Rahmati, Amir
    Bates, Adam
    WEB CONFERENCE 2020: PROCEEDINGS OF THE WORLD WIDE WEB CONFERENCE (WWW 2020), 2020, : 939 - 950
  • [44] Serverless in the Wild: Characterizing and Optimizing the Serverless Workload at a Large Cloud Provider
    Shahrad, Mohammad
    Fonseca, Rodrigo
    Goiri, Inigo
    Chaudhry, Gohar
    Batum, Paul
    Cooke, Jason
    Laureano, Eduardo
    Tresness, Colby
    Russinovich, Mark
    Bianchini, Ricardo
    PROCEEDINGS OF THE 2020 USENIX ANNUAL TECHNICAL CONFERENCE, 2020, : 205 - 218
  • [45] WiseFuse: Workload Characterization and DAG Transformation for Serverless Workflows
    Mahgoub A.
    Yi E.B.
    Shankar K.
    Minocha E.
    Elnikety S.
    Bagchi S.
    Chaterji S.
    Performance Evaluation Review, 2022, 50 (01): : 57 - 58
  • [46] FaaSPipe: Fast Serverless Workflows on Distributed Shared Memory
    Tong, Ruizhe
    NETWORK AND PARALLEL COMPUTING, NPC 2022, 2022, 13615 : 83 - 95
  • [47] Characterizing commodity serverless computing platforms
    Wen, Jinfeng
    Liu, Yi
    Chen, Zhenpeng
    Chen, Junkai
    Ma, Yun
    JOURNAL OF SOFTWARE-EVOLUTION AND PROCESS, 2023, 35 (10)
  • [48] Serverless Computing for Scientific Applications
    Malawski, Maciej
    Balis, Bartosz
    IEEE INTERNET COMPUTING, 2022, 26 (04) : 53 - 58
  • [49] Towards Federated Learning using FaaS Fabric
    Chadha, Mohak
    Jindal, Anshul
    Gerndt, Michael
    PROCEEDINGS OF THE 2020 SIXTH INTERNATIONAL WORKSHOP ON SERVERLESS COMPUTING (WOSC '20), 2020, : 49 - 54
  • [50] Real-Time FaaS: Towards a Latency Bounded Serverless Cloud
    Szalay, Mark
    Matray, Peter
    Toka, Laszlo
    IEEE TRANSACTIONS ON CLOUD COMPUTING, 2023, 11 (02) : 1636 - 1650